Between the 16th and the 17th centuries, it was rebuilt, and completely remade in 1861-62, when its orientation was turned of 90 degrees. Of the medieval setting only the fa\u00e7ade ending in a gable, and the lintelled portal with archivolt, are left. In the right flank a sculpted lintel is embedded. By unknown author, it dates back to the late 11th century, and it surely comes from the Pisa-Lucca artistic environment. It represents a man holding an elaborate floral shoot, and real and imaginary animals. Inside, the single hall is entirely due to the 19th century rebuilding.<\/p>\n
